Psychiatrists are medical professionals
Psychiatrists are medical physicians who specialize in dealing with psychological health conditions. They can identify and deal with several conditions, consisting of depression, anxiety, and bipolar affective disorder. They also provide psychiatric therapy and prescribe medications. They can work in medical facilities, private practice, or with community psychological health services. Some psychiatrists specialize in particular locations of psychiatry, such as kid psychiatry. Others work in public and private health centers, and some even travel to backwoods to take care of clients.
Besides diagnosing psychological disorders, psychiatrists can also recommend medication to aid with symptoms. Medications can change the way chemicals in the brain communicate with each other, and they may improve your state of mind or lower symptoms. A few of these medications include antidepressants, benzodiazepines, and state of mind stabilizers. It's important to remember that these medications need to be utilized in combination with psychotherapy.
Psychotherapy is a kind of treatment that includes talking with a professional about your feelings and ideas. Psychiatric therapy can be short or long term, and it's typically a crucial part of treating psychological disease. Psychiatrists can likewise recommend other treatments, such as electroconvulsive therapy (ECT). It's best to bring a list of your symptoms to your appointment. They diagnose and treat mental illness
Psychiatrists are medical physicians who specialize in the diagnosis and treatment of mental health conditions. They can work in medical centers, hospitals, and private practice. They are able to prescribe medication, and frequently deal with psychologists, social workers, and main care doctors to supply detailed mental health services. They also carry out research study and teach other health care specialists about psychiatry.
Detecting mental health disorders: Psychiatrists use a range of tools and methods to diagnose psychiatric conditions. These consist of physical tests, interviews, and psychological tests. They also examine a client's case history and family history to assist them determine whether the signs relate to a physical disease or a psychological disease. Psychiatrists work carefully with patients to develop treatment plans, which may include medication or psychotherapy.
Treatment: Psychiatrists treat a broad range of mental health conditions. They may prescribe medication, such as antidepressants, hypnotics, and mood stabilizers, to manage depression, stress and anxiety, bipolar illness, and other conditions. They may likewise advise psychotherapy, such as cognitive behavior modification, to deal with the underlying causes of the condition. They can likewise use other treatments, such as light treatment and deep brain stimulation (DBS), to deal with extreme depression that does not react to medications.
It can be hard to recognize when a person requires psychiatric care. Signs such as loss of interest in daily activities, sensations of hopelessness, or hearing voices are serious signs that it's time to see a psychiatrist. Psychiatrists can assist identify and treat these issues, which are normally triggered by chemical imbalances in the brain.
Psychiatrists are trained in all aspects of psychological health and can treat a broad variety of illnesses, including depression, bipolar condition, stress and anxiety, and schizophrenia. They can work in clinics, health centers, and private practice, and may even be associated with street psychiatry. Unlike psychologists, who do not recommend medication, psychiatrists are licensed to do so and can provide a more holistic approach to treatment. In addition to prescriptions, they can likewise help patients manage their negative effects and monitor their development. Some psychiatrists also do research and teach, and might release their findings in medical journals.
They recommend medication
Psychiatrists detect and treat psychological health conditions through medication management. They are medical physicians who concentrate on the diagnosis and treatment of mental disorder, and they work carefully with psychologists, social employees, and psychiatric nurse specialists. Psychiatrists likewise operate in hospital wards, neighborhood mental health groups, and private practices. They frequently have a double specialized in Functional Medicine Psychiatrist Near Me (Https://Link-Forbes-2.Blogbright.Net/) and psychology, enabling them to utilize both psychotherapy and medications to deal with mental health conditions.
While psychiatrists and psychologists share some similar characteristics, they differ in their approach to treatment. Psychiatrists are medical doctors and can recommend medication, while psychologists can just provide psychiatric therapy (talk therapy). The difference is essential due to the fact that psychiatric diseases can often have physical symptoms. For example, people with depression can have high blood pressure or other physical problems. In these cases, a psychiatrist can assess whether the patient's depression is triggered by a medical condition or a psychiatric disorder.
Unlike psychologists, psychiatrists have actually finished medical school and are licensed doctors. They have actually concentrated on psychiatry and are familiar with the connections in between mental and physical health. They are experts in the treatment of mental disorders and can deal with clients with both psychotherapy and medication. Psychiatrists are likewise more qualified to treat complicated and serious conditions, such as bipolar disorder or schizophrenia.

They provide psychotherapy
If you have a mental health condition, it is crucial to look for treatment. A psychiatrist can help you with a range of conditions, consisting of depression, stress and anxiety, and bipolar disorder. They can also prescribe medication to alleviate signs. Psychiatric therapy, or talk therapy, can help you handle your psychiatric condition and improve your lifestyle. There are a range of types of psychotherapy, and your psychiatrist will figure out the best type for you. Throughout your initial consultation, your psychiatrist will ask you questions about your psychological health and family history to assist them identify your condition. After they do, they'll produce a personalized prepare for you. Depending on your diagnosis, the psychiatrist may suggest medication or psychotherapy.
Many people see both a psychiatrist and therapist for their mental health needs. Psychiatrists have specialized medical training in psychiatry and can diagnose and deal with a large range of disorders. They also recommend medications and can treat a large range of mental disorders. Psychiatrists are certified to prescribe medication, which can be beneficial for some individuals who have a serious mental disorder.
Psychotherapy, or talk treatment, is a kind of psychological treatment that involves a healing relationship between a patient and a trained therapist. It can be used to deal with a variety of conditions, such as schizophrenia, depression, anxiety, and phobias. It can be conducted in an individual, couple, or group setting and can last for a few weeks or months to years.
Psychiatrists often carry out talk therapy with their clients, specifically if they are prescribing medication. These sessions generally focus on evaluating how well the medication is working, talking about side impacts, and resolving any concerns. They can also refer their clients to a therapist or therapist for psychotherapy.
